By Bonnie Burns, Training and Policy Specialist CIGNA has sold its Medicare business to Health Care Services Corporation (HCSC). An insurance company named Medco Containment Life Insurance Company, or MCLIC, is a wholly owned subsidiary of HCSC and will be the new insurer for Cigna’s previous Medicare Supplement business. California Health Advocates is a proud co-sponsor of the Medigap Access and Protection Act (SB 242 – Blakespear). This bill would establish a 90-day annual open enrollment period for people enrolled in Medicare Part B, during which applications for Medicare supplement coverage would be accepted without discrimination based on health status or age. Currently, opportunities for Medicare beneficiaries to enroll in a Medigap policy without a health screening are few and far between. The main opportunity is when one first turns 65 and/or becomes eligible for Medicare, followed by other very specific and limited open enrollment and guaranteed issue rights corresponding to certain circumstances or life events.
